Service Care Solutions is recruiting an experienced Event Coordinator to work as a Contributions Coordinator for a public sector client in Runcorn, Cheshire.
Job Purpose
To scale up the successful “Cheshire Contribution” pilot projects that revitalise green and open spaces across the county, enabling people seeking asylum to visibly contribute to local communities and supporting social cohesion through volunteering and co‑design.
Role Accountabilities
- Lead the planning, delivery and on‑site coordination of Cheshire Contribution events and projects.
- Ensure efficient processes, including day‑of event management and task completion.
- Produce an operational guide: checklists, inductions, safety protocols and risk assessments.
- Arrange and confirm equipment and resources needed to complete tasks.
- Develop marketing materials and support promotion to attract stakeholders, local communities and volunteers.
- Recruit and coordinate volunteers and local residents; identify local hosts and convenors and maintain ongoing liaison.
- Build relationships with local authorities, public bodies and partners to co‑create high‑visibility projects.
- Act as the single point of contact for the programme, advising participants and partner agencies.
- Track outcomes and produce reports and case studies, supporting communications activity and key messaging.
